hbase是在hdfs基础之上的,可以算是数据的一种组织方式,是一种基于hadoop的分布式数据库系统。从数据库的角度来说,与mysql处在同一个层次,都是基于文件系统之上的管理数据的一种方法。
hbase作为面向列的数据库,支持按列读取和行读取,并解决了关系型数据库的分表的一些需求,如:关系型数据库中有些表的列重复数据太多了,需要重新建表来存重复列的数据,减少表的大小。
hive和impala则更偏向于查询分析,impala需要依赖hive的元数据,它们都有自己的查询分析引擎,只是impala是纯查询分析引擎。
hive 本身并不执行任务的分析过程,而是推给了mapreduce,这点与impala大不同,hive本身提供了数据的格式化输出功能,但是hive转换的mr可能不是最高效的,调优方式有限,很多复杂的算法没有办法表达,毕竟sql的语义表达能力有限。
hive与impala在查询分析这部分,hive明显的支持程度要比impala高,提供了很多内部函数,并且支持UDAF,UDF的方式
从数据库特性角度来看,hive与hbase的对比,hive不能修改数据,只能追加的方式,hbase允许增加和删除数据,hive不支持索引,impala和hive都是没有存储引擎的,hbase算是有自己的存储引擎。
在使用层面上来看,hive在使用上更像数据库,它提供非常丰富的系统函数,各种数据的 *** 作,hbase在这方面就不太像一般的关系型数据库,它还是一个key-val的NoSQL,这方面的 *** 作支持很有限,impala在这方面也是比较弱。
在计算模型层面上来看,hive是通过MR来计算的,这是一个偏向挪动数据到mr的计算节点来计算的模型,而impala则更多的是移动计算需求到DN上来做,数据不用动,最后变成了本地的磁盘IO。
kgfjshgfds'ghkfdl'kbfdlgkrfpd[itgreg.,fdmpoxbviskgs.dgk'fdlkgh'sotreghfd,B vgi grkk'fd'ihkpoeritylrtedmhb'ofdigre,g[fob
DZglfds'ghkfdhksflgtjkhkbf,cbjp'odehtg,m'DFGKfkdjhb,mcofkgjbfdl'hkgf,.mhbogflk'hlgfkh
吴阿敏二十四式太极拳分解教学下载地址合初学者 : 在土豆网找到的,想要下载的话,则先需要简单注册用户(免费的),然后下载并安装土豆网的软件,之后登陆用户,然后点击页面上的下载提示而下载(免费的)文件,下载完成后用土豆网的软件将文件转化成为avi格式即可。
24式太极拳01
http://www.tudou.com/programs/view/0nTaF5uGA6U/
24式太极拳02
http://www.tudou.com/programs/view/NtWXe5KlsY8/
24式太极拳03
http://www.tudou.com/programs/view/nRhQvPQVqDI/
24式太极拳04
http://www.tudou.com/programs/view/9vXJBA2iOJw/
24式太极拳05
http://www.tudou.com/programs/view/MX5B_TRugyg/
24式太极拳06
http://www.tudou.com/programs/view/Zgg1btoPRAM/
24式太极拳07
http://www.tudou.com/programs/view/3Z7qslV3Ncw/
24式太极拳08
http://www.tudou.com/programs/view/4WCDZh9GK2k/
24式太极拳09
http://www.tudou.com/programs/view/0CTZydbpU2Y/
24式太极拳10
http://www.tudou.com/programs/view/GJUZPOOl9QU/
24式太极拳11
http://www.tudou.com/programs/view/YGKSzuTwACQ/
24式太极拳12
http://www.tudou.com/programs/view/14xD7FKFkSU/
24式太极拳13
http://www.tudou.com/programs/view/zl0_ULMoWCo/
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)